#154fad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#154fad is composed of 8.2% red, 31% green and 67.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.9% cyan, 54.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 32.2% black. It has a hue angle of 217.1 degrees, a saturation of 78.4% and a lightness of 38%. #154fad color hex could be obtained by blending #2a9eff with #00005b. Closest websafe color is: #006699.

#154fad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#154fad has RGB values of R:21, G:79, B:173 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0.54, Y:0, K:0.32. Its decimal value is 1396653.

Shades and Tints of #154fad
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020710 is the darkest color, while #fdfeff is the lightest one.
